How IQ Assessments Are Administered to Young children
IQ tests for children is actually a diligently structured method that requires specialised training and controlled environments. The assessment normally normally takes position inside of a silent, distraction-totally free space with a professional psychologist or skilled examiner. Young children usually are analyzed independently rather then in teams to be certain exact success and correct interest to each Kid's requires.
The tests course of action normally spans one particular to a few hours, according to the child's age and attention span. Examiners usually break the session into lesser segments with breaks to circumvent tiredness, as fatigued youngsters may not accomplish at their finest. The environment is built to be at ease and non-threatening, with examiners trained To place little ones at simplicity although preserving standardized methods.
Over the assessment, youngsters engage with various jobs which could seem like games or puzzles. These functions are very carefully designed to evaluate different areas of cognitive capacity with no kid emotion pressured or conscious they are increasingly being formally evaluated. The examiner observes not just the kid's answers and also their issue-fixing approach, consideration span, and reaction to problems.
The Gold Conventional: Wechsler Intelligence Scales
The most widely identified and Formal IQ check for kids is the Wechsler Intelligence Scale for kids, now in its fifth edition (WISC-V). This thorough evaluation is taken into account the gold normal in pediatric intelligence screening and is particularly acknowledged by universities, psychologists, and academic institutions around the world.
The WISC-V evaluates small children aged 6 to 16 a long time and actions 5 primary cognitive domains: verbal comprehension, visual spatial processing, fluid reasoning, Functioning memory, and processing pace. Each individual area consists of several subtests that evaluate precise cognitive competencies. For instance, the verbal comprehension area could consist of vocabulary checks and similarities responsibilities, whilst the visual spatial part could contain block design problems and visual puzzles.
For young young children aged 2 to 7 several years, the Wechsler Preschool and Primary Scale of Intelligence (WPPSI-IV) serves given that the equivalent assessment Instrument. This Model is precisely tailored for youthful awareness spans and developmental levels, incorporating more Perform-based mostly functions though maintaining rigorous measurement standards.
The Stanford-Binet Intelligence Scales represent another respected choice, specifically valuable for kids with Extraordinary capabilities or developmental delays. This examination can assess folks from age 2 by means of adulthood and gives thorough Examination across 5 cognitive variables.
Why Private Elementary Educational facilities Demand IQ Tests
Personal elementary educational facilities more and more involve IQ tests as portion of their admissions system for various interconnected motives. Primarily, these establishments use cognitive assessments to guarantee tutorial compatibility among incoming students as well as their rigorous curricula. Schools with accelerated or specialised programs really need to discover small children who can handle State-of-the-art coursework with no turning into confused or disengaged.
The selective mother nature of many non-public faculties means they get more apps than available places. IQ scores provide an goal evaluate that helps admissions committees make hard conclusions When picking between likewise skilled candidates. Unlike grades or Instructor suggestions, that may vary substantially involving schools and educators, standardized IQ scores provide a reliable metric for comparison.
Lots of private colleges also use IQ screening to build well balanced lecture rooms and advise their teaching methods. Knowing the cognitive profiles of incoming pupils lets educators to tailor instruction solutions, identify children who may want further assist, and identify people that would take pleasure in enrichment opportunities. This data-pushed solution allows educational facilities improve Each individual university student's probable when retaining their educational specifications.
Furthermore, some private schools specialise in serving gifted pupils or People with certain Studying profiles. For these establishments, IQ tests is essential for identifying small children who'd thrive of their specialised environments. Colleges centered on gifted education and learning normally appear for college kids more info scoring in the highest percentiles, while others could possibly find particular cognitive styles that align with their academic philosophy.
Considerations for folks
Mothers and fathers considering IQ screening for school admissions really should realize that these assessments give useful insights beyond admission prerequisites. The in depth cognitive profile might help establish a child's strengths and regions for growth, informing educational selections and Studying procedures throughout their educational journey.
Having said that, it's important to bear in mind IQ scores signify only one element of a child's skills and probable. Creativity, emotional intelligence, drive, and social abilities all lead appreciably to educational and life good results. The best academic environments look at various elements when evaluating college students and supporting their enhancement.
Mothers and fathers must also assure their boy or girl is very well-rested and comfy on tests day, as these things can considerably effect functionality. Knowledge which the evaluation is designed to evaluate present-day cognitive abilities as opposed to predict foreseeable future results may also help manage correct anticipations and reduce anxiety for both of those parents and youngsters.
